One option among the formatting functions related to the formatting of text is “Grow Font”. A button for it is included in the “Font” section of the “Home” tab in “Word 2010 Ribbon”. To use the function, first the user has to select the text for which he/she want to increase the font size and then have to click on the button for “Grow Font” function from the “Font” section in Home tab. The clicking will increase the font size by the next value of the font-size among various available. Steps to use grow font feature of font section in Home tab for Word 2010: -
1. Select the text for which you want to increase the font size and then, from the “Word 2010 Ribbon” click on the “Home” to view formatting options included in it.

2. Now click on the “Grow Font” button from the “Font” section of the Home tab in “Word 2010 Ribbon”, which will increase the font size by next value mentioned in the selection list of font size.

3. You will notice that the font size is now increased by the next value mentioned in the selection list of font sizes.
